Why Have A PTA At Kings Copse  
The PTA supports the school by providing refreshments at school events, arranging fun activities and social events for the children and their families and raising funds to buy equipment and resources.
 
We aim to build effective relationships between staff and parents to enhance the learning experience of the children during their time at Kings Copse.
 
When your children join Kings Copse School you automatically become a member of the PTA.  Why not get involved – you will be very welcome.  Is there something you or your family have a particular interest in that you could share with the children or families at the school?
